## Signing Plugin Artifacts

Hey plugin folks — before Quotaloom will accept your per-tenant quota plugin, the bundle has to be signed, otherwise the marketplace bot bounces it. Run `qloom sign bundle.zip` and you're done. Quota configs themselves don't need signing, just the artifact. To verify our side of the handshake, the platform's current signing key is below.

release key, yagap-kagag: bky6_1ks93y

The Fernhollow greenhouse controller applies a rolling baseline correction to each humidity and CO2 sensor, since the Halloway probes drift measurably per week of continuous operation. From a security standpoint, note that the correction factors are computed locally and never accepted from the network; an attacker cannot push a baseline that masks real readings. Corrections are clamped to a hard ceiling, and any sensor exceeding it is marked untrusted and excluded from actuation decisions. The clamp and window parameters are defined below.

tuning constants:
QUOTAS = {
    "druwyn": 5,
    "holix": 5,
    "zorath": 5,
    "holwyn": 10,
}

## Configuration

Branchreaper scans all repositories in the Fennel Systems org nightly and flags branches with no commits in 90 days. Flagged branches get a warning comment; after 14 more days they are deleted unless labeled `keep`. Thresholds live in `reaper.toml` and can be overridden per repo. Dry-run mode (`REAPER_DRY_RUN=1`) logs actions without deleting — use it after any config change. The bot needs write access to the forge API, granted via a token set in the env file on the line below.

secret setting of hawep-yahig: LEDGER_TOKEN29=41b5d6315371c92885eaeb077fb63

Ticket: Hardware lab access — Brindlewood Annex, Level 2. Requester: Tomas Vell, Verdant Loop team. Needs entry to the lab for the Kestrel rig rebuild starting Monday. Current badge not provisioned for the lab reader. Please add lab permissions for two weeks, standard weekday hours only. Safety induction completed last quarter, certificate on file with Facilities. Escort not required after day one. Approved by lab lead Priya Onstead. Use the temporary pass code below until the badge update propagates.

turnstile pass: bdg-YPPQB-52010